Transaction 16e23ce96deb601084a5e43afab91e02cd08bb25b5144522109b3eba925d2609
1 Input
1 Output
-
16e23ce96deb601084a5e43afab91e02cd08bb25b5144522109b3eba925d2609:0
- value
- 25373
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b58c0e9d9f761fa09ca13a6192a490cd4bdf87fe9401ec99097ea78899cb404e
- address
- bc1pkkxqa8vlwc06p89p8fse9fyse49alpl7jsq7exgf06nc3xwtgp8qdgglh9